Iran to become Malaysia’s palm oil hub, acting as gateway into the region

AFTER experiencing a massive dive in bilateral trade activities between Malaysia and Iran due to border closures caused by the pandemic, the latter is set to strengthen ties with Malaysia as both countries go through economic recovery.

From 2016 to 2018, Iran-Malaysia trade witnessed significant growth following Iran’s Nuclear Deal in 2015. The bilateral trade value of the two countries also rose to RM4.52 bil in 2017 from RM2.82 bil in 2016.

This year, despite the lingering uncertainties due to the pandemic, Iran continues to boost palm oil imports with a significant growth from January to May (compared to the same period in 2020).

According to the latest data, Iran tops the list for palm oil import volume this year among nine other Middle Eastern countries in the region.

The statistics show Iran imported a total of 309,704 metric tons of palm oil from January to May this year, seeing a whopping five-fold growth in comparison to last year’s 63,039 metric tons for the same period.

With that, Iran aims to continue increasing palm oil imports from Malaysia to reach one million metric tons and above annually in a bid to address the growing demand over the next few years.

However, this would require better coordination and cooperation from the relevant ministries, government-linked companies and agencies to further strengthen the bilateral ties towards a mutual goal.

To further fuel the industry and re-escalate bilateral trade activities, Iran plans to continue increasing palm oil imports as the country paves the way into economic recovery.

Additionally, Iran is also ready to become Malaysia’s hub for distribution of palm oil and palm oil-related products into the lucrative markets in West Asia and Central Asian countries bordering its country.

Doing so will allow for more strategic bilateral trade ties between the two nations to make each other a gateway to other countries. – July 17, 2021
